Baltimore synth-rock duo Wye Oak just released a fun new music video for their single "The Tower" from their upcoming fourth studio album, Shriek.
"The Tower" is a guitar-free tune, driven mostly by melancholy vocals and a pulsating synth. The video abandons the notion of a downtrodden laboring class as we follow two dancing painters and a group of frolicking factory workers as they twirl through an empty warehouse. The entire spectacle is whimsical, surreal and sure to put a smile on your face.
Shriek is out April 29th on Merge Records and is currently available for preorder on Amazon and iTunes.
